Step 2
In Your Quest For New Clients
Tell the World
Most new
small business owners seem shy about their new status. They do
not want to be seen as pushy or (heaven forbid) selling anything
to their friends and close acquaintances. This is specially true
if they work from home. If they have opened retail premises they
might mumble, "I've opened a Gift Shop." but they do not want to
impose on their friends.
Your
attitude must change. You are happy about your new
status, aren't you? It is natural to tell your friends and
whoever you meet about what is making you happy isn't it?
Your family and friends will be your best customers in the
beginning and it's a win-win situation. You have a great service
and not only that but your friends get what they need.
Will they be bored? Not at all! It's better
than listening to Uncle Rob's lawn bowls stories they've heard a
dozen times or Uncle Kel's jokes that were old when Adam was a
boy. The novelty will wear off but by then every one will know
you are running a business.
Buying bread in
your normal shop? How hard is it to say, " Guess what, I don't
work for that Accounting Firm anymore. I've gone into business
for myself. I'll be completing State Tax Returns for my own
clients now instead of the Boss's."
You have
seen him every day for years so will he be interested? He
sure will because
you are an important
customer and he wants to keep you happy. He'll be glad to
take some of your cards. Ask him if he has any tips for a new
business owner. You will be pleasantly surprised at what it can
lead to.
You've just been appointed a wedding
celebrant and do not have any clients yet. Tell the people at
your gym. People are always interested in what a celebrant does
and enjoy talking about it. Give them some cards so they can
refer you to those friends who are thinking of getting married.
People love to use people they know rather than strangers.
But they must know that you are in the game,
first.
And the very best thing
about this type of promotion is that it is free and it works.
